怎么采集网站小说:高效抓取与使用技巧揭秘

网站小说采集的基本概念与技巧

如今,网络小说已经成为许多人休闲娱乐的主要方式,尤其是一些优质的小说网站,提供了海量的小说资源。由于版权问题和网站更新频繁,很多读者希望能够将自己喜欢的小说完整地保存下来,或是通过自己的方式对小说内容进行个性化的处理。这时,采集网站小说就成为了一项非常有用的技能。

一、采集网站小说的基本步骤

要采集网站上的小说内容,首先需要了解基本的采集步骤。通常来说,采集网站小说可以分为以下几个步骤:

分析网页结构

在开始采集之前,首先需要了解目标网站的结构。大部分小说网站采用HTML语言编写,页面内容通常通过

等标签展示。通过右键点击网页,选择“查看页面源代码”,你可以看到网页的HTML结构。通过分析这些标签,你可以找到小说章节内容的位置。

选择采集工具

如果你希望高效地进行小说采集,使用爬虫工具是必不可少的。爬虫是一种自动化的程序,它可以帮助你模拟人工浏览网页,抓取网站上的信息。Python语言中的BeautifulSoup和requests库,是目前最常用的网页抓取工具,它们能够快速解析网页,提取需要的内容。

编写爬虫脚本

一旦你确定了需要抓取的网页结构和内容,就可以编写爬虫脚本来进行采集。比如使用requests库发送HTTP请求获取网页源代码,然后通过BeautifulSoup解析HTML内容,提取小说的章节标题和正文部分。通常来说,你只需要编写几行代码,就能够实现对指定小说页面的抓取。

存储数据

采集到小说内容后,如何存储这些数据也是一个重要的问题。你可以将小说内容存储为本地文件,如文本文件(.txt)或Markdown格式,方便后续的查看和编辑。如果希望对小说进行更深入的处理,甚至可以将其存储到数据库中,进行分类、索引等操作,便于管理和搜索。

二、注意事项

尽管采集网站小说是一个非常有用的技能,但在实际操作过程中,我们需要注意一些重要的事项:

版权问题

在采集小说时,版权问题是一个不容忽视的法律风险。许多小说网站的内容都是受到版权保护的,未经授权地复制和分发这些内容可能导致侵权行为。因此,在进行小说采集之前,务必了解相关法律法规,确保自己的行为不会侵犯他人的知识产权。

网站反爬虫机制

许多小说网站都有一定的反爬虫机制,例如通过IP封禁、验证码验证、动态加载数据等方式,防止程序自动化抓取网站内容。为了解决这些问题,可以使用代理IP、设置请求头,甚至通过模拟人工操作来绕过反爬虫机制。

避免过度抓取

不要过度抓取网站内容,尤其是对于一些小型网站,频繁、大量的请求可能会导致网站服务器负担过重,甚至使网站崩溃。合理设置抓取间隔时间,避免对网站造成不必要的压力。

三、如何高效利用抓取的数据

采集到网站小说的内容后,你可以根据自己的需求进行多种用途的处理。例如:

离线阅读:将抓取的小说存储为离线文件,随时随地阅读。

自定义处理:根据个人喜好修改小说内容,如去除广告、修改格式、分章排序等。

数据分析:如果你对小说内容有较深的兴趣,可以进行数据分析,例如分析小说的词频、情节发展等。

通过合理利用采集的数据,你可以获得更好的阅读体验或进行更为专业的研究。

如何优化采集流程与技术难题的解决方案

在进行网站小说采集时,除了基本的抓取技巧外,如何提高抓取效率、解决技术难题以及确保数据的准确性,也成为了重要的问题。我们将介绍一些进阶技巧,帮助你更高效地完成小说采集任务。

一、提高采集效率的技巧

多线程与异步抓取

如果你要采集大量的小说页面,单线程抓取的速度可能会很慢。为了解决这一问题,可以使用多线程技术或异步爬取方法,来加速数据抓取过程。例如,在Python中,threading模块可以帮助你实现多线程抓取,而aiohttp库则能够实现异步HTTP请求,从而显著提高抓取速度。

定时采集与增量更新

对于一些持续更新的小说,如果你每次都从头开始抓取,显然是浪费了大量时间和资源。为了提高效率,可以使用定时任务和增量更新的方式。你可以定期检查某个小说的更新情况,只采集新增的章节,而不是重新抓取整个小说的内容。

二、如何应对网站的反爬虫机制

网站为了防止大规模抓取,通常会使用反爬虫机制来限制自动化程序的行为。常见的反爬虫措施包括IP封禁、验证码、J*aScript渲染等。为了解决这些问题,可以采取以下方法:

使用代理IP

当频繁访问网站时,IP封禁是最常见的反爬虫手段。为了避免被封禁,你可以使用代理IP池,每次发送请求时更换IP,从而绕过IP限制。

模拟浏览器行为

一些网站通过J*aScript渲染内容,直接获取网页源代码可能无法获得完整的小说内容。为了解决这一问题,可以使用像Selenium这样的浏览器自动化工具,模拟人工操作来抓取动态加载的内容。Selenium可以控制浏览器打开网页,并自动执行点击、滚动等操作,从而获取完整的网页数据。

验证码破解

有些网站使用验证码来防止爬虫抓取。对此,你可以使用验证码识别服务,或者使用图像识别算法来破解验证码。不过需要注意的是,这种做法可能会涉及到一定的法律风险,因此要谨慎使用。

三、如何确保数据的准确性与完整性

数据采集不仅仅是获取内容那么简单,确保数据的准确性和完整性也是非常重要的。为了避免在采集过程中出现错误,可以采取以下措施:

校验数据

在抓取每一章节内容时,可以通过校验机制,确保每次抓取的小说章节内容完整无误。例如,可以在每次抓取前后,验证小说的章节标题、发布时间等信息,确保数据的一致性。

自动化测试

定期进行自动化测试,检查抓取脚本是否能够正确提取目标数据,避免因为网站结构变化导致抓取失败。

通过以上优化手段,你可以在保证高效性的最大程度地提高采集结果的准确性和完整性。

结语:合法合规的采集,创造更好的体验

网站小说采集技术为我们带来了诸多便利,但我们在采集过程中必须要遵循法律法规,避免侵犯版权。通过使用合适的工具和技术,合理、合规地抓取小说内容,不仅能提高我们的阅读体验,还能为我们带来更多的创作和研究机会。


标签: #采集网站小说  #小说抓取  #网站数据采集  #爬虫工具  #小说下载  #网站内容抓取  #  #  #免费网站建设方案优化学 A  #抖音集成灶的关键词排名I  #  #福州谷歌seo公司户  #工业产品网站优化排名研  #网络关键词seo排名优化服务究ai  #ai智能写  #长尾关键词排名查询工具作测评  #exgpt ai  #  #宜宾抖音seo团队招聘AI中医调理  #A  #关键词排名优化工i画手绘  #王者荣耀ai觉悟打法  #ai形状生  #英山网站seo优化开发成器怎么用  #ai忠诚  #  #衢州关键词排名优化需要多少钱查看ai软件 


#采集网站小说  #小说抓取  #网站数据采集  #爬虫工具  #小说下载  #网站内容抓取  #  #  #免费网站建设方案优化学 A  #抖音集成灶的关键词排名I  #  #福州谷歌seo公司户  #工业产品网站优化排名研  #网络关键词seo排名优化服务究ai  #ai智能写  #长尾关键词排名查询工具作测评  #exgpt ai  #  #宜宾抖音seo团队招聘AI中医调理  #A  #关键词排名优化工i画手绘  #王者荣耀ai觉悟打法  #ai形状生  #英山网站seo优化开发成器怎么用  #ai忠诚  #  #衢州关键词排名优化需要多少钱查看ai软件 


相关文章: 排名优化费用企业如何通过合理投资获得最大回报  ChatGPT下载Win:一键智能助手,提升工作与生活效率  企业网站排名提升软件优化:助力您的企业脱颖而出  用上这个用户分类方法,或许能减少你50%的品牌推广成本  如何用八爪鱼快速采集数据:高效抓取的秘诀  迈向智能未来,GPT4O国内通道为您开启无限可能  在线网站优化:提升用户体验与搜索引擎排名的必备策略  免费免登录AI:革新你的工作与生活方式  苹果CMS域名防红辅助插件安装全攻略  360ai写文案,助力企业突破营销瓶颈!  提升武汉企业竞争力,专业SEO优化助力网站腾飞  2017产品经理千人峰会QQ空间刘镇伟谈社会化营销  DeepSeek怎么设置中文,让你轻松应对搜索挑战  浅谈网络营销的成功模式  打造成功自媒体的秘密武器-自媒体SEO培训  AI写作有哪些软件?创作新机遇  海外写作平台的魅力与机会:如何让你的文字走向世界  好利来 X 可口可乐推出新品,灵感来自AI...  中小企业在网络营销过程中转化率问题  专业SEO推广价格解析,如何选择合适的SEO服务?  全网营销与传统营销有什么区别?  ChatGPT:下一个智能对话系统的前景与挑战  分享几种非常实用的网站推广方法  网站的信息更新:提升用户体验,赢得市场先机  AI写作在线制作-提升写作效率,创造无限可能  SEO引擎优化平台助力企业提升网络曝光度的利器  提升品牌影响力,选择专业的SEO优化服务让你事半功倍  WordPress发布的文章会丢失?如何避免这一问题,保障网站内容安全  国外AI智能软件:开启未来科技之门  数据时代的宝贵财富:在线爬虫技术带你走在行业前沿  网站关键词怎样优化,助你轻松登上搜索引擎首页  Chat18OS-引领智能聊天新时代的革命性操作系统  网站关键词排名优化系统:提升网站流量的智能解决方案  360收录网站入口:提升网站曝光与排名的强大助力  如何用爬虫收集公服点位,轻松获取精准数据  网站SEO推广方法,提升网站流量与排名的实战技巧  SEO发布网:企业网络营销新机遇,助力精准推广与高效转化  免费AI写文,助你轻松创作优质内容  如何做一个网站的SEO,让你的网站排名飙升!  电影解说破解版追剧神器,超强电影解析,让你领略不一样的视听盛宴!  教你如何开启GPT-4OMini模型(GPT-3.5已下线)  ChatGPT启动慢是网络原因吗?如何解决这个问题?  ChatGPT访问量骤降,悄悄解禁中国账号,OpenAI何必当初!  网络推广SEO优化:助力企业实现品牌突破,轻松占领市场高地  提升网站流量的秘密武器关键词排名网站SEO优化  提升SEO网站排名的秘密武器,助你打破竞争壁垒!  移动快速排名系统:让你的网站一夜间引爆流量,快速跻身搜索引擎榜单!  关键词指向产品页还是标签页?精准营销,提升转化率的最佳策略  外贸网站优化:助力全球市场的成功之路  中文AI润色的无限可能,让文字更加精准动人 


相关栏目: 【AI智能写作11743

南昌市广照天下广告策划有限公司 南昌市广照天下广告策划有限公司 南昌市广照天下广告策划有限公司
南昌市广照天下广告策划有限公司 南昌市广照天下广告策划有限公司 南昌市广照天下广告策划有限公司
南昌市广照天下广告策划有限公司 南昌市广照天下广告策划有限公司 南昌市广照天下广告策划有限公司
广照天下广告 广照天下广告 广照天下广告
广照天下广告策划 广照天下广告策划 广照天下广告策划
广照天下 广照天下 广照天下
广照天下广告策划 广照天下广告策划 广照天下广告策划
广照天下 广照天下 广照天下
广照天下广告策划 广照天下广告策划 广照天下广告策划
南昌市广照天下广告策划有限公司 南昌市广照天下广告策划有限公司 南昌市广照天下广告策划有限公司
南昌市广照天下广告策划有限公司 南昌市广照天下广告策划有限公司 南昌市广照天下广告策划有限公司
广照天下 广照天下 广照天下